Israeli Oil: Black Gold in the Holy Land
(June 18, 2011) On Tuesday, June 14, Zion Oil & Gas, Inc. announced it had requested a petroleum exploration permit to develop large shale oil deposits in the Shfela Basin, 30 miles west of Jerusalem. Continue reading
